Hermes Extraordinary Collection 30cm Diamond, Matte Black Porosus Crocodile Birkin Bag with 18K White Gold HardwareJ Square, 2006
Excellent to Pristine Condition
12" Width x 8" Height x 6" Depth
The paramount luxury accessory, the Diamond Birkin is the highest expression of exceptional craftsmanship. To the astute collector, obtaining a Diamond Birkin is nearly impossible from boutiques, and thus becomes the capstone piece to an exceptional collection. With that said, it pleases us to be able to bring this incredible relic of Hermes lore to the secondary market. This Birkin bag is done in Matte Black Porosus Crocodile, one of Hermes's most highly prized skins. The bold Black is offset perfectly with 18K White Gold Hardware, which is studded with White Diamonds. The cadena lock is enshrined in 68.4 grams of 18K White Gold and encrusted with 40 VVS F White Round Brilliant Diamonds, totaling 1.64 Carats. On the bag itself, the Touret features 7 diamonds, the Pontets feature 16, and the Plaques feature 182, for a total of 8.2 Carats of VVS F Round Brilliant Diamonds set in 10 grams of 18K White Gold. The interior is done in matching Black Chevre Leather and features one slip pocket and one zip pocket. This bag includes two keys, a lock, and a clochette.
This bag is in Excellent to Pristine Condition. The interior shows some light scuffing. This bag includes an Hermes box, dustbag, clochette dustbag, lock box and dustbag, a rain protector, care card, and a diamond information card.

Condition Rankings:
Pristine - shows little to no indication of handling.
Excellent - shows very minor evidence of handling.
Very Good - shows evidence of wear and handling, with no major flaws.
Good - shows moderate wear and is fully functional.
Fair - shows moderate wear and has condition issues that may or may not be repairable.
References to gold or silver hardware, unless otherwise specified, describes the color and is not meant to infer the type of metal.
